How to validate a SaaS idea in a weekend

How to validate a SaaS idea in a weekend — three cheap tests that beat market research and tell you whether to build the thing.

Test 1: The $1 landing page

One headline, one promise, one email field. Spend $50 on targeted ads. If you can't get a 5% signup rate from cold traffic that already has the problem, the problem isn't sharp enough yet.

Test 2: The pre-sale

Offer the thing for half price to the first 10 buyers. Stripe link, no product yet. If five strangers pay, you have a business. If zero do, you have a hobby — better to find out now.

Test 3: The walk-through

Sketch the core flow in Figma. Sit with five people in your target market and watch them try to explain what each screen does. If they can't, the value prop is wrong, not the design.

What doesn't count as validation

Friends saying 'cool idea'. LinkedIn likes. Survey results from people who'll never pay. Validation means money or signed intent — anything else is theatre.
